Just got myself an '89 DX this week and noticed an abnormal noise coming from the tranny that seems to come and go. Sounds like a rattling or grinding noise throughout driving speeds and sometimes in idle. goes away when clutch is depressed ... anyone know what this might be? Any help would be appreciated!

lol, well, if you can remove the trans yourself, it will cost 40-50 bucks for the bearing. Go to www.majestichonda.com . They have every genuine Honda part you would ever need. You'll have to search your car and then under the transmission (or similar) category find the throwout bearing and order it.

But, if you can't remove the tranny yourself, I'd assume a shop or dealership would want 200+ bucks because of the labor to remove the trans and then they always double the price of the parts.
